package org.openecard.ws.jaxb;
import java.util.LinkedList;
import java.util.TreeSet;
import javax.xml.namespace.NamespaceContext;
import javax.xml.stream.XMLStreamException;
import javax.xml.stream.XMLStreamWriter;
/**
* Wraps {@link XMLStreamWriter} to get namespace prefix customization working.
*
* @author Dirk Petrautzki <petrautzki@hs-coburg.de>
* @author Tobias Wich <tobias.wich@ecsec.de>
*/
public class XMLStreamWriterWrapper implements XMLStreamWriter {
private static class PrefixList {
public final String localName;
public final TreeSet<String> prefixes = new TreeSet<String>();
public PrefixList(String localName) {
this.localName = localName;
}
}
private final XMLStreamWriter writer;
private LinkedList<PrefixList> hierarchy = new LinkedList<PrefixList>();
private TreeSet<String> activePrefixes = new TreeSet<String>();
public XMLStreamWriterWrapper(XMLStreamWriter writer) throws XMLStreamException {
writer.setPrefix("iso", "urn:iso:std:iso-iec:24727:tech:schema");
this.writer = writer;
}
private void pop() {
PrefixList list = hierarchy.pop();
activePrefixes.removeAll(list.prefixes);
}
private void push(String localName) {
hierarchy.push(new PrefixList(localName));
}
private void addNS(String prefix, String ns) throws XMLStreamException {
if (! activePrefixes.contains(prefix)) {
activePrefixes.add(prefix);
hierarchy.peek().prefixes.add(prefix);
writer.writeNamespace(prefix, ns);
}
}
@Override
public void writeStartElement(String prefix, String localName, String namespaceURI) throws XMLStreamException {
push(localName);
writer.writeStartElement(prefix, localName, namespaceURI);
writeNamespace(prefix, namespaceURI);
}
@Override
public void writeEndElement() throws XMLStreamException {
pop();
writer.writeEndElement();
}
@Override
public void writeNamespace(String prefix, String namespaceURI) throws XMLStreamException {
addNS(prefix, namespaceURI);
}
